What to Look For in a Bunk Bed Price
Bunk beds can be an excellent option for saving space in a bedroom that is shared. They also come in handy for those who need an extra guest bed.
The price of bunk beds varies based on the design, size and brand, safety features and materials. It can vary from $50 to $4000.
Size
Bunk beds are a great option to save space in small bedrooms. However, before you make your purchase, make sure you take measurements of the space in which you intend to place it. This will help you choose a bunk bed that will fit in the space and doesn't take up too much.
Standard bunk beds measure 39 inches by 70 inches, and their height can vary from 63 to 65 inches based on the design. They can be constructed in an L-shaped design with the top bunk is parallel to the bottom.
These beds are typically less expensive than other models, however they take up more space in the bedroom. You can also choose to purchase bunk beds built with stairs on their sides, making it more secure for children to climb up and down from the upper bunk.
A futon mattress could also be used as a lower bunk. Futon mattresses are typically thinner than normal full or twin size mattresses and are available in different sizes.
The standard twin mattress is the most commonly used kind of mattress for bunk beds. This mattress is 75 inches long and 38 inches wide. It can be used on the top bunk as well as the bottom bunk.
If you need a slightly longer mattress, consider getting a twin XL mattress. It's the same width as a twin, but it has five inches more length. This is the same size as a queen mattress or king. This is an excellent option for teens and adults who are advancing and need a bit more room in their bedroom.
Other options include a full bunk bed which is similar to a twin bed but has an additional 15 inches of space on the side. This is more commonly used by college students and teenagers who share a room, although it's not as popular like the other two types of bunk beds.

Stairs or Ladders
There are a few things to keep in mind when you add ladders or stairs to your bunk beds. You should first consider your child's ability to climb stairs or climb ladders. Keep in mind also the space available in your child’s room.
If your child is older, they may have more experience climbing stairs or ladders and will be able to safely navigate them. Nevertheless, children who are younger should still be watched by an adult when using these options.
Stairs are safer than ladders for children because they have more tread and a built-in handrail. They also provide the biggest surface for standing on, which reduces the risk of injury should they fall down.
Storage drawers are usually placed underneath every step of a bunk bed, which includes stairs. This provides extra storage for your child's clothes and other things, thereby saving space in other areas of the room.
It is possible to spend a little more on a bunk bed that has stairs than one without this feature. These extras could be worth the price.
It is crucial to remember that your child shouldn't be allowed to sleep in the top bunk until they turn six years old. It's better to wait until your child is at the age of readiness rather than risk an accident.
